Humanoid Robot Statistics 2026
By Axis Intelligence Research and Liam Michael | Last updated: June 18, 2026 | Next scheduled update: Q3 2026 (September) | License: CC BY 4.0
Quick Answer: The humanoid robot market generated approximately $4.89 billion in revenue in 2025 and is projected to reach $6.24 billion in 2026 — but cumulative sector VC funding exceeded $9.8 billion by end-2025, with 2026 Q1 funding alone up 288% year-over-year. The industry shipped an estimated 16,000–18,000 units globally in 2025, Chinese manufacturers accounted for approximately 90% of volume, and Figure AI’s BMW Spartanburg pilot — 30,000+ vehicles produced, 1,250+ operating hours, 90,000+ parts handled over 10 months — became the first independently verifiable commercial humanoid production result in history.
Key Findings
- Global humanoid robot shipments grew an estimated 508% in 2025 to approximately 18,000 units, with Chinese manufacturers (led by AgiBot and Unitree) accounting for close to 90% of volume — per cross-source analysis of IFR, Omdia, and company disclosures.
- Cumulative venture capital investment in humanoid robotics exceeded $9.8 billion by end-2025, with 2026 already adding $2.37 billion through Q1 alone — a 288% increase vs. the same period in 2025, per Tracxn.
- Goldman Sachs projects a $38 billion humanoid robot market by 2035 — revised 6× upward from a prior $6 billion estimate, reflecting accelerating supply chain maturation. Morgan Stanley’s $5 trillion estimate for 2050 includes the full humanoid ecosystem at approximately 1 billion units deployed.
- Figure AI’s BotQ factory reached 1 robot per hour production rate in June 2026 — the first time any humanoid manufacturer demonstrated automated sustained production throughput. The company’s Figure 02 logged 1,250+ operating hours at BMW’s Spartanburg plant over 10 months, contributed to the production of 30,000+ BMW X3 vehicles, and handled 90,000+ sheet metal parts — the only Tier 1 verified commercial deployment by any humanoid manufacturer globally.
- Tesla Optimus ranks 7th on the Axis Intelligence HCRI — despite dominating media coverage — because Elon Musk confirmed on the Q4 2025 earnings call that Optimus robots inside Tesla factories are deployed “to generate training data, not productive labor.” HCRI scores what robots are doing commercially, not what companies say they will do.
The HCRI: Axis Intelligence’s Humanoid Commercial Readiness Index
The humanoid robot industry in 2026 is defined by a massive gap between narrative and evidence. Every competitor claims leadership. No existing benchmark distinguishes between a robot that has performed 1,250 hours of verified factory production work and a robot that appeared in a staged demo video.
Axis Intelligence Research introduces the Humanoid Commercial Readiness Index (HCRI) — the first evidence-based composite metric scoring humanoid robot companies across four dimensions with explicit evidence tiers.
HCRI Evidence Standards
Before scoring, we apply a three-tier evidence standard to all deployment claims:
Tier 1 (Verified): Named customer confirmed by both parties; audited or independently reported operational metrics (units produced, hours logged, tasks completed).
Tier 2 (Confirmed): Named customer partnership disclosed by both parties with operational timeline; volume or unit data from company disclosure without independent audit.
Tier 3 (Projected): Company-stated targets, roadmaps, or aspirational claims without external confirmation.
A robot in a demo video is not a deployment. A robot in a staged event is not evidence. HCRI scores only what companies have proven, not what they have announced.
HCRI Methodology
| Dimension | Weight | What it measures |
|---|---|---|
| Verified deployment evidence | 40% | Tier 1 or Tier 2 commercial deployment proof |
| Production scale maturity | 30% | Demonstrated ability to manufacture at volume |
| AI / software maturity | 20% | Autonomous task completion; VLA model capability |
| Price accessibility | 10% | Current or target unit price vs. enterprise ROI thresholds |
Formula: HCRI = (deployment × 0.40) + (production × 0.30) + (ai_maturity × 0.20) + (price_access × 0.10)
HCRI Results — June 2026 Snapshot
| Rank | Company | Robot | Deployment | Production | AI | Price | HCRI | Tier |
|---|---|---|---|---|---|---|---|---|
| 1 | Figure AI | Figure 02/03 | 82 | 72 | 70 | 45 | 72.9 | 🟢 Commercial |
| 2 | Agility Robotics | Digit | 88 | 55 | 65 | 60 | 70.7 | 🟢 Commercial |
| 3 | Unitree Robotics | G1 / H1 | 55 | 85 | 50 | 100 | 67.5 | 🟢 Commercial |
| 4 | AgiBot | A2 | 60 | 80 | 55 | 70 | 66.0 | 🟢 Commercial |
| 5 | Boston Dynamics | Atlas (electric) | 70 | 60 | 85 | 20 | 65.0 | 🟢 Commercial |
| 6 | Apptronik | Apollo | 65 | 55 | 70 | 40 | 60.5 | 🟡 Emerging |
| 7 | Tesla | Optimus Gen 2/3 | 30 | 50 | 65 | 75 | 47.5 | 🟡 Emerging |
| 7 | NEURA Robotics | 4NE-1 | 40 | 50 | 65 | 35 | 47.5 | 🟡 Emerging |
| 9 | 1X Technologies | NEO | 45 | 35 | 60 | 65 | 47.0 | 🟡 Emerging |
| 10 | Physical Intelligence | π0 | 35 | 20 | 90 | 50 | 43.0 | 🔴 Early |
CC BY 4.0 — Axis Intelligence Research, June 2026. Dataset downloadable below.
The three findings that matter most:
Figure AI ranks first, not Tesla. The BMW deployment provides Tier 1 evidence no competitor has matched. Media coverage of humanoid robots is inversely correlated with commercial evidence — Tesla dominates headlines, Figure AI dominates deployments.
Agility Robotics ranks second despite minimal media coverage. 100,000+ totes moved at GXO, Toyota Canada active units, Mercado Libre deployment, and the first Tier 1 logistics customer of any humanoid company worldwide. Tracxn independently scores Agility as the #1 humanoid company globally by operational score.
Physical Intelligence ranks last despite the highest AI score. π0’s vision-language-action model is the most capable humanoid AI available — but it is a software company. Its 90/100 AI score reflects genuine supremacy on the only dimension it competes on.
The Market — Size, Funding, and Why the Numbers Disagree
The humanoid robot market is simultaneously one of the most discussed and least understood markets in technology. Analyst estimates diverge by a factor of 30–50×. Understanding why requires separating three distinct markets.
The three humanoid markets:
| Market | 2025 Revenue | 2030–2035 Estimate | What it includes |
|---|---|---|---|
| Current hardware revenue | ~$4.89B | $15.26B by 2030 (MarketsandMarkets) | Actual units sold at actual prices |
| Addressable TAM (optimistic) | — | $38B by 2035 (Goldman Sachs) | If costs fall and adoption scales |
| Full ecosystem (blue sky) | — | $5T by 2050 (Morgan Stanley) | Hardware + software + services at ~1B units |
Axis Intelligence editorial position: The $4.89 billion 2025 figure is the most credible current-revenue estimate. Goldman Sachs’s $38 billion 2035 projection is a scenario analysis — it requires specific cost curves, regulatory frameworks, and enterprise adoption rates to materialize. Morgan Stanley’s $5 trillion 2050 figure describes what happens if humanoid robots reach smartphone-level ubiquity. Presenting them as equivalent figures is the most common misrepresentation in humanoid market coverage.
Global shipment trajectory:
| Year | Estimated Units | YoY Change | Key Driver |
|---|---|---|---|
| 2023 | ~200–500 | — | Research and pilot only |
| 2024 | ~3,000 | +500% | First commercial deployments |
| 2025 | ~16,000–18,000 | +508% | Chinese manufacturer volume surge |
| 2026E | ~25,000–40,000 | +56–122% | BotQ ramp; Tesla Gen 3; Unitree 10k–20k target |
| 2028F | ~100,000–200,000 | — | If all announced ramps execute |
Funding Landscape (Cumulative Through Q1 2026)
Cumulative sector VC exceeded $9.8 billion by end-2025 (Tracxn). Q1 2026 alone added $2.37 billion — a 288% increase vs. Q1 2025. Broader robotics startup funding hit $14 billion in 2025 per Crunchbase — the highest year on record, exceeding the 2021 peak of $13.1 billion.
| Company | Total Funding | Valuation | Latest Round |
|---|---|---|---|
| Figure AI | ~$1.9B | $39B | Sep 2025 Series C (>$1B) |
| Skild AI | $2B+ | $14B+ | Jan 2026 ($1.4B) |
| NEURA Robotics | ~$1.4B+ | ~$7B | Jun 2026 Series C (up to $1.4B) |
| Apptronik | ~$935M | ~$5.3B | Feb 2026 Series A extension ($520M) |
| Physical Intelligence | $800M+ | $11B (projected) | $1B round in active talks |
| Agility Robotics | ~$400M+ | Undisclosed | Amazon ecosystem investment |
The pattern: capital is concentrating in companies with both deployment evidence AND AI platform ambitions. Figure AI’s $39B valuation on less than $2B raised reflects investor conviction that deployed humanoid data — not just hardware — creates a defensible moat.
Verified Deployments — The Evidence That Separates Hype from Reality
Figure AI — BMW Spartanburg (Tier 1 Verified)
Verified metrics (confirmed by both Figure AI and BMW Group):
- 10+ months of sustained factory operation (mid-2025 to early 2026)
- 30,000+ BMW X3 vehicles produced with Figure 02 involvement
- 90,000+ sheet metal parts loaded into welding fixtures
- 1,250+ operating hours logged on active production line
- 5-millimeter precision on part insertion within 2 seconds per cycle
- 10-hour shifts, five days per week
June 2026 production milestone: Figure AI’s BotQ factory achieved 1 robot per hour production throughput. Figure is targeting 1,000+ units in 2026, 10,000+ in 2027.
September 2025 Series C: More than $1 billion at a $39 billion post-money valuation — backed by Nvidia, Microsoft, Bezos Expeditions, Intel Capital, Salesforce, T-Mobile Ventures, LG, Qualcomm, and Align Ventures. A 15× valuation increase in 18 months from a $2.6 billion starting point.
Agility Robotics — Amazon, GXO, Toyota (Tier 1 Verified)
Agility Robotics’ Digit is arguably the most commercially proven humanoid robot globally, despite receiving a fraction of Tesla’s media coverage.
Verified deployments:
- Amazon: Warehouse testing confirmed; ongoing operational deployment
- GXO Logistics: Multi-year commercial agreement; 100,000+ totes moved — the highest verified task volume of any humanoid globally
- Toyota Canada: 7+ units active under Robot-as-a-Service (RaaS)
- Mercado Libre: Deployment confirmed 2025
Agility’s RaaS model — where customers pay per robot per shift — has proven the fastest path to verified deployment. Enterprise customers test ROI without capital commitment; Agility collects real-world data at scale.
Unitree Robotics — Volume at Price (Tier 2 Confirmed)
Unitree shipped 5,500+ humanoid units in 2025 at prices no Western competitor matches:
- G1: $16,000 — lowest commercially available price for a functional bipedal humanoid
- R1: $5,900 — unveiled late 2025, pre-orders active; education and consumer targeted
- 2026 target: 10,000–20,000 units
Boston Dynamics — Enterprise-Grade Mobility (Tier 2 Confirmed)
Production Electric Atlas launched at CES 2026. All 2026 units are fully committed to Hyundai Motor Group and Google DeepMind. Hyundai targets 30,000 Atlas units per year from 2028. Estimated pricing: $150,000–$320,000 per unit. Boston Dynamics has the most advanced locomotion technology of any humanoid manufacturer — but premium pricing and Hyundai ownership limit deployment scale outside the automaker’s ecosystem.
Tesla Optimus — The Hype vs. Evidence Gap (Tier 3 Projected)
Tesla Optimus receives more media coverage than any humanoid robot. On the HCRI, it ranks 7th.
What Tesla has confirmed:
- Q4 2025 Musk earnings statement: robots deployed “to generate training data, not productive labor”
- Tesla missed its 2025 production target (5,000–10,000 units) by more than 80% per The Information and LatePost Auto
- Q1 2026: Fremont factory conversion to humanoid production announced; 1 million units/year target capacity
What has not been confirmed: Third-party commercial deployments; autonomous (non-teleoperated) operation at scale; any production ramp with external validation.
Bloomberg (October 2024), Electrek, TechCrunch, and The Verge have separately documented patterns suggesting some of Tesla’s most prominent Optimus public demos involved teleoperation. This is not disqualifying — all manufacturers use teleoperation during development — but it is relevant context for interpreting demo footage.
Tesla’s long-term structural advantages are real: Fremont manufacturing, AI5 chip, Cortex 2.0, $41 billion in cash, FSD training infrastructure. “Best positioned to win eventually” and “leading commercially today” are different judgments.
Apptronik — Google’s Hardware Partner (Tier 2 Confirmed)
Apptronik’s Apollo is the exclusive hardware platform for Google DeepMind’s Gemini Robotics project — the most significant AI partnership in the humanoid sector.
Key facts:
- Deployed at Mercedes-Benz Berlin-Marienfelde, GXO Logistics, and Jabil
- $935M total raised at ~$5.3B valuation (February 2026)
- Investors: Google, Mercedes-Benz, B Capital, AT&T Ventures, John Deere, Qatar Investment Authority
- Targeting commercial production in 2026 with $1B in projected demand from existing commitments
The Geopolitical Dimension
China: ~90% of 2025 global humanoid shipments; AgiBot 5,100+ units (39% market share, Omdia); Unitree G1 commercially available at $16,000; government target of 59 million units deployed by 2050. The structural supply chain advantage is significant — building Optimus without Chinese components raises BOM from ~$46,000 to ~$131,000.
United States: Leads on AI integration quality, enterprise deployment validation, and capital ($3.02B total VC vs. China’s $2.3B per Tracxn). Figure’s $39B valuation vs. Unitree’s $16,000 G1 represents the market pricing Western AI at an extraordinary premium over Chinese manufacturing scale.
Europe: NEURA Robotics (Germany) raised up to $1.4 billion in June 2026 — backed by Nvidia, Amazon, Qualcomm, Bosch, Schaeffler, and the European Investment Bank — at a reported $7 billion valuation. The largest European robotics investment in history. Europe’s humanoid strategy emphasizes industrial trust, regulatory compliance, and integration into existing manufacturing ecosystems.
The three-way race: China leads on manufacturing scale and price. The U.S. leads on AI and capital. Europe is building around industrial trust and regulation. The winners will be the companies that turn deployments into data, data into capability, and capability into reliable customer economics.
Applications and Labor Economics
Primary deployment applications (2025–2026):
| Application | Share | Leading Companies |
|---|---|---|
| Automotive manufacturing | ~35% | Figure (BMW), Boston Dynamics (Hyundai), Apptronik (Mercedes) |
| Logistics / warehousing | ~25% | Agility (Amazon, GXO), Apptronik (GXO), Unitree |
| Research / development | ~15% | Unitree, 1X, Physical Intelligence |
| Government / defense | ~10% | Classified programs |
| Consumer / home | ~5% | 1X NEO (pre-order 2026) |
| Other commercial | ~10% | Promobot (800+ units, 47 countries) |
Why the RaaS model dominates: Current humanoid pricing ($50,000–$320,000 per unit) creates prohibitive capital requirements. Robot-as-a-Service lowers adoption barriers and aligns manufacturer incentives with robot performance. Agility, Apptronik, and Boston Dynamics all offer RaaS as their primary commercial model.
The cost curve is the whole thesis: At $50,000–$100,000, humanoids are justified only in high-value applications (automotive, high-volume logistics). At $20,000–$30,000 (Tesla’s target), the addressable market expands dramatically. At $16,000 (Unitree current), early adopter economics become positive for a wide range of manufacturing SMEs. Goldman Sachs projects 1 million annual humanoid shipments by the early-to-mid 2030s — contingent on this cost curve materializing.
Methodology
How Axis Intelligence Research and Liam Michael compiled this data:
- Company primary disclosures: Figure AI/BMW partnership metrics (confirmed by both parties); Agility/GXO multi-year commercial agreement; Tesla Q4 2025 and Q1 2026 earnings transcripts (direct quote: “training data, not productive labor”); Boston Dynamics CES 2026 production announcement; Unitree commercial pricing and shipping disclosures; Apptronik (TechCrunch verified); NEURA June 2026 Series C announcement
- Named institutional research: Goldman Sachs ($38B by 2035, 2024); Morgan Stanley ($5T by 2050); Tracxn funding database ($9.8B cumulative, $2.37B Q1 2026); Crunchbase ($14B robotics 2025); Omdia (AgiBot 5,100+ units, 39% market share); Fortune Business Insights ($4.89B 2025 revenue); MarketsandMarkets (39.2% CAGR)
- Verified reporting: Bloomberg teleoperation documentation; The Information Tesla production miss; TechCrunch Apptronik $5.3B; Crunchbase Apptronik funding
HCRI limitations: Deployment scores are assigned per evidence tier — Tier 1 deployments score 80–90, Tier 2 score 50–75, Tier 3 score 20–50. AgiBot’s 5,100+ unit figure comes from Omdia, not AgiBot directly — “shipped” may include R&D and demo units. Tesla deployment numbers are entirely unverifiable from public sources. All HCRI scores will be updated when new primary evidence becomes available.

Frequently Asked Questions
How many humanoid robots exist in 2026?
Global humanoid robot shipments reached an estimated 16,000–18,000 units in 2025 — a 508% year-over-year increase — with Chinese manufacturers accounting for approximately 90% of volume. Total active commercial deployments (productive work, not R&D) are estimated at fewer than 3,000–4,000 units globally, concentrated at Amazon, GXO, BMW, Hyundai, Mercedes-Benz, and Toyota facilities. The gap between “shipped” and “productively deployed” is the most important number most analyses omit.
What is the humanoid robot market size in 2026?
The market generated approximately $4.89 billion in revenue in 2025, projected to reach $6.24 billion in 2026. Goldman Sachs projects $38 billion by 2035 — a 6× revision upward. Morgan Stanley’s $5 trillion 2050 projection encompasses the full ecosystem at approximately 1 billion units deployed. These figures measure fundamentally different things; always cite with time horizon and methodology.
What is the HCRI?
The Humanoid Commercial Readiness Index (HCRI) is a proprietary composite metric by Axis Intelligence Research (June 2026). It scores 10 humanoid robot companies across verified deployment evidence (40%), production scale (30%), AI maturity (20%), and price accessibility (10%). Figure AI ranks first at 72.9. Tesla ranks 7th at 47.5 — reflecting the gap between media coverage and commercially verified deployment. Released under CC BY 4.0.
Which humanoid robot is the most commercially advanced?
By HCRI, Figure AI’s Figure 02/03 leads at 72.9 — backed by the BMW Spartanburg Tier 1 verified deployment. By operational breadth, Agility Robotics (Digit) at 70.7 has the widest verified footprint: Amazon, GXO (100,000+ totes), Toyota Canada, Mercado Libre. By volume shipped, Unitree leads with 5,500+ units in 2025, commercially available from $16,000.
Is Tesla Optimus commercially deployed?
Not as of Q4 2025 per Musk’s own earnings statement. Tesla’s CEO explicitly characterized Optimus factory robots as deployed “to generate training data, not productive labor.” Tesla has not confirmed any third-party commercial deployments. The Q1 2026 Fremont conversion announcement is a strategic declaration; production has not begun. Tesla’s structural advantages (FSD infrastructure, Dojo, $41B cash) may eventually produce market leadership — but “best positioned to win eventually” and “leading commercially today” are different judgments.
How much has been invested in humanoid robots?
Cumulative VC in humanoid robotics exceeded $9.8 billion by end-2025 (Tracxn). Q1 2026 added $2.37 billion — a 288% increase vs. Q1 2025. The largest rounds: Figure AI $1B+ Series C at $39B (Sep 2025); Skild AI $1.4B (Jan 2026); NEURA Robotics up to $1.4B Series C (Jun 2026); Apptronik $935M total. Broader robotics startup funding hit $14 billion in 2025 per Crunchbase — the highest year on record.
What do humanoid robots cost in 2026?
Unitree R1: $5,900 (pre-order). Unitree G1: $16,000 (commercially available). Tesla Optimus target: $20,000–$30,000 at scale (not yet available). Boston Dynamics Atlas: $150,000–$320,000 estimated (enterprise-only, no official MSRP). Most enterprise deployments use RaaS pricing rather than unit purchase, making per-unit price secondary to cost per shift relative to human labor.
Which company is winning the humanoid robot race?
The answer depends on the metric. By media coverage: Tesla. By verified commercial deployment (Tier 1): Figure AI. By deployment breadth: Agility Robotics. By volume shipped: AgiBot (China). By price accessibility: Unitree. By AI software quality: Physical Intelligence. By physical capability: Boston Dynamics. By European industrial position: NEURA Robotics. No single company leads across all dimensions — which is precisely what the HCRI was designed to make explicit.
What is China’s role in humanoid robots?
China accounts for approximately 90% of global humanoid robot shipments by volume (2025), led by AgiBot (5,100+ units, 39% market share per Omdia) and Unitree (5,500+ units shipped). The government targets 59 million humanoids in domestic deployment by 2050. Building a humanoid without Chinese components raises BOM from ~$46,000 to ~$131,000 — a structural cost advantage with significant geopolitical implications for the supply chain strategies of Western manufacturers.
